NICOLO DELL'ABATE


I509/i2(?)-i57i

25 Marriage of a Patrician Couple

Oil on paper, some foreground figures pricked for trans-
fer; H: 40.6 cm (16 in.); W: 47.8 cm (i8I3/i6 in.)
87.00.4 1


MARKS AND INSCRIPTIONS: None.


PROVENANCE: Sale, Christie's, London, April 8, 1986,
lot 28; art market, London.


EXHIBITIONS: None.
BIBLIOGRAPHY: None.

THIS IS ONE OF FOUR KNOWN STUDIES BY NiCOLO
dell'Abate of chivalric subjects which are related in size,
shape, and style (the others are UfFizi inv. 593 E; Louvre
inv. 20.746; and Windsor Castle, Royal Library inv.
6317). A lost drawing by him, known through a copy in
Munich (Staatliche Graphische Sammlung inv. 14209),
must also have been associated with them. With the ex-
ception of the Museum's study, which was only discov-
ered recently, the others were grouped by S. Beguin.^1 She
suggested that they were made for a cycle depicting
scenes from the romantic epics Orlando furioso and Or-
lando innamorato, perhaps for Giulio Boiardo's palazzo at
Scandiano or for the Palazzo Ducale, Sassuolo, where a
series of five scenes from the life of Orlando by Nicolo
are known to have existed until well into the eighteenth
century. The Getty drawing, which first appeared at auc-
tion in 1986 at Christie's, was related by Beguin to the
Uffizi study,^2 with which it shares a similar technique,
having been made in oil on paper (the Windsor and
Louvre sheets are drawn in pen and ink). The disparity
in technique within the group might indicate that there
were two stages in the later evolution of the project, the
latter of which is represented by the highly finished oil
sketches. The style of this series, informed by the work
of Giulio Romano and Dosso Dossi, places it early i n Ni-
colo's career, circa 1535-40.
